Monthly readership respecting ‘world
class journalism and iconic photography’
Readership
wanting ‘high brand values and integrity. A carefully crafted musical archive
covering the very best of music across genres. From classic and modern rock,
folk, soul, country to reggae, electronic and experimental. It prefers to
celebrate quality over popularity – music that will stand the test of time.’
Readership want a magazine that is packed with insight, passion, and revelatory
encounters with the greatest musicians of all-time, be they established or
emerging musicians. The magazine is loved by its readers and artists alike
because it engages them on the subject they love the most: music itself.
Readership wants a definitive cover
feature on an iconic act; a bespoke CD (especially compiled by the editorial
team or a major musician in MOJO’s world);
the famous reviews section, the Filter, which brings you 30 pages-plus
of the best of that month’s music, both classic and contemporary.
The readership wants information and input from guest editors e.g. David
Bowie, Noel Gallagher. They want information a magazine that can provide
breadth and iconic status among musicians e.g. The Beatles, Led Zeppelin, Laura
Marling or from Fleetwood Mac to Flying Lotus.
Readership enjoy brand extensions eg Cambridge
festival; Greenman; MOJO honours list
Readership wants daily downloads from www.mojo4music.com for a daily
updates and gossip.
Magazine publishers do a great deal of research to ensure they deliver a product that meet the needs and requirements of their target audience. This information will influence all aspects of the production through typography to photography to features and freebies.
